Carres Grammar 1961 66
A Memory of Sleaford.
Remember this being built (original buildings 1604) - chased Mark Wallington across the freshly laid concrete (he was a cheeky beggar) and as we ‘splodged’ through the wet concrete, with the workmen shouting after us, l yelled “Keep going ..!!”. He went on to captain Leicester City whilst l (in the RAF) was merely ‘scouted’ at the same time Peter Shilton was there ..!
PS. My mother (Nora/Lynn) was District Nurse and Midwife from circa 1962/63 to 79/80.
